Questions says to use the graph to determine the number of solutions the system has. where system of equations are x=4 and y=x+3
any equation of the form x=k is a vertical line crossing x-axis at k.
So x=4 is a vertical line crossing x-axis at 4.
y=x+3 has slope m=1 and y-intercept b=3
So it passes through point (0,3) and for slope m=1, rise 1 up then 1 right to get new point.
Then final graph is given as shown in the picture.
We can see that both lines intersect at point (4,7).
Hence final answer is x=4, y=7.
